Overview

Why mold tape testing matters

Not every dark patch is mold. Tape testing is a fast, reliable method for confirming whether visible buildup is fungal and identifying the species behind it, before assumptions drive an expensive cleanup.

Mold tape testing detects:

  • Mold on walls, ceilings, and furniture surfaces
  • Visible buildup on smooth or dusty areas
  • Species identification on painted and finished walls
  • Early growth caught before it has time to spread

About

How mold tape testing works

Our certified mold inspectors press a clear adhesive slide against the suspect area to capture a thin layer of surface material. The slide is sealed and sent to a state-certified lab for mold species identification.

Our process includes:

  • Surface sampling with sterile adhesive slides
  • Lab analysis for species type and contamination level
  • Lab-verified results with spore counts where relevant
  • A mold inspection report with clear next steps

Original copper plumbing in 1950s and 1960s West Covina homes is now 60 to 70 years old and showing the pinhole leak pattern characteristic of this material at the end of its service life — a failure mode that delivers sustained moisture to wall cavities without producing visible surface staining or dramatic water events that would trigger immediate investigation. Slab foundations in these properties were poured without the vapor retarder layers that current building codes require, meaning ground moisture migration through the slab has been occurring since construction and has had decades to establish moisture conditions in flooring materials and lower wall assemblies. Single-pane aluminum windows in these homes generate seasonal condensation that runs down interior wall surfaces and accumulates at the base of wall framing — a chronic, low-level moisture source that is rarely traced back to its origin until mold growth becomes visible.
